    Duties

    The Lead Purchasing Agent duties include, but are not limited to:
    • Advises approving officials and purchase card holders on purchase card program, procurement procedures and responsibilities.
    • Coaches and problem solves with team members.
    • Delegate follow up action on undelivered orders and aged purchase card transactions to close out purchase orders.
    • Provides advice on work methods, practices and procedures.
    • Instructs Purchasing Agents in specific tasks and job techniques and make available written instructions, and reference materials.
    • Ensures timely purchasing under the micro purchase threshold.
    • Leads the coordination for sources of supplies and acceptable substitutions.
    • Initiates sand provides training to acquisition and technical staff on the procurement process.
    • Makes purchases involving specialized requirements and/or commercial requirements that have unstable price or product characteristics, hard-to-locate sources, or similar complicating factors.
    • Provides procurement support throughout the procurement cycle.
    • Conducts open market research for purchases of routine equipment, supplies, and services.
    • Examines incoming procurement requests for completeness.
    • Recommends or makes decisions based on analysis of various trade-offs (e.g. cost of renting vs. purchasing, free services included, vendor reputation or past performance).
    • Reviews completed work to see that instructions on work sequence, procedures, methods and deadlines have been met.
    • Identifies training needs and gives on the job training.
    • Distributes and balances workload among employees and assure completion of assigned work.
    • Identifies factors to determine the best offer applicable for procurement.
    • Maintains accountable procurement records and auditing information.
    • Instructs employees in specific tasks and job techniques and provide written instructions, reference materials and supplies.
    • Estimates and reports on expected time of completion of work.
    • Monitors purchase requests and active and delinquent invoices, and process receipts.
    • Utilizes Microsoft Office to create, edit and aggregate data necessary for expense tracking and Supply Chain management reporting.
    • Maintains catalogs, contract files, and lists of firms offering specific equipment, supplies, and services.
    • Develops reports and spreadsheets, obtain and organize files, and retrieve reports for briefings and presentation purposes.
    • Compiles, consolidates, organizes, and summarizes specific procurement information to support efforts related to annual budget estimates and a variety of one-time and recurring reports.
    • Analyzes descriptions and characteristics to identify problem areas.
    • Develops recommended alternatives or solutions prior to completion of the procurement action when problems are encountered and/or deviations are required.
    • Resolves disputes and informal complaints among medical staff and customers.
    • Assesses urgency of patient needs and recommends source adjustments to meet patient and medical center needs.
    • Plans and coordinates actions to prevent, correct, or resolve delays or misunderstandings in the purchasing process.

    Time-In-Grade Requirement: Applicants who are current Federal employees and have held a GS grade any time in the past 52 weeks must also meet time-in-grade requirements by the closing date of this announcement. For a GS-07 position you must have served 52 weeks at the GS-06. The grade may have been in any occupation, but must have been held in the Federal service. An SF-50 that shows your time-in-grade eligibility must be submitted with your application materials. If the most recent SF-50 has an effective date within the past year, it may not clearly demonstrate you possess one-year time-in-grade, as required by the announcement. In this instance, you must provide an additional SF-50 that clearly demonstrates one-year time-in-grade. Note: Time-In-Grade requirements also apply to former Federal employees applying for reinstatement as well as current employees applying for Veterans Employment Opportunities Act of 1998 (VEOA) appointment.

    You may qualify based on your experience as described below:
    • Specialized Experience: You must have one year of specialized experience equivalent to at least the next lower grade GS06 in the normal line of progression for the occupation in the organization. Examples of specialized experience would typically include, but are not limited to: procuring supplies and services to meet the purchase, rental, or lease needs of an organization; assisting in training new employees and answering questions on purchasing/procurement procedures, policies, etc.; purchasing various equipment, supplies, and services through the use of a purchase card; working with medical staff to determine procurement needs and priorities; resolving a variety of shipment, payment, or other discrepancies in support of procurement programs and operations; and, assembling and/or summarizing information from files and documents as required to create reports utilizing automated computerized supply/inventory management systems and Microsoft Office software programs such as MS Word and Excel.

    The Interagency Career Transition Assistance Plan (ICTAP) and Career Transition Assistance Plan (CTAP) provide eligible displaced Federal/VA competitive service employees with selection priority over other candidates for competitive service vacancies. To be qualified you must submit appropriate documentation (a copy of the agency notice, your most recent performance rating, and your most recent SF-50 noting current position, grade level, and duty location) and be found well-qualified for this vacancy. To be well-qualified: applicants must possess experience that exceeds the minimum qualifications of the position including all selective factors, and who are proficient in most of the required competencies of the job.       NOTE: Participation in the seasonal influenza program is a condition of employment and a requirement for all Department of Veterans Affairs Health Care Personnel (HCP). It is a requirement that all HCP to receive annual seasonal influenza vaccination or obtain an exemption for medical or religious reasons. Wearing a face mask is required when an exemption to the influenza vaccination has been granted. HCP in violation of this directive may face disciplinary action up to and including removal from federal service. HCP are individuals who, during the influenza season, work in VHA locations or who come into contact with VA patients or other HCP as part of their duties. VHA locations include, but are not limited to, VA hospitals and associated clinics, community living centers (CLCs), community-based outpatient clinics (CBOCs), domiciliary units, Vet centers and VA-leased medical facilities. HCP include all VA licensed and unlicensed, clinical and administrative, remote and onsite, paid and without compensation, full- and part-time employees, intermittent employees, fee basis employees, VA contractors, researchers, volunteers and health professions trainees (HPTs) who are expected to perform any or all of their work at these facilities. HPTs may be paid or unpaid and include residents, interns, fellows and students. HCP also includes VHA personnel providing home-based care to Veterans and drivers and other personnel whose duties put them in contact with patients outside VA medical facilities.
